Page 169 - C:\Users\RENO\Documents\MK Sistem Operasi\Folder Baru\
P. 169
melayani permintaan-perminataan, dan memeriksa hubungan posisi di antrian
permintaan. Antrian disusun kembali sehingga permintaan akan dilayani dengan
pergerakan mekanis minimum.
(B.1). First Come First Served Scheduling (FCFS)
Algoritma First Come First Served Scheduling (FCFS) ini merupakan bentuk
yang paling sederhana karena sistemnya menggunakan sistem antrian (queu). Pada
algoritma ini proses yang pertama kali datang maka pertama kali dilayani, smentara
proses yang laiya berada dalam posisi mengantri (queue).
(B.2). Shortest Seek Time First Scheduling (SSTF)
Algoritma ini memiliki permintaan proses berdasarkan waktu pencarian atau
seek time paling minimun dari posisi head saat itu. Karena waktu pencarian meningkat
seiring dengan jumlah silinderyang dilewati oleh head, maka SSTF memilih permintaan
yang waktunya paling mendekati posisi di sidk terhadap posisi head saat itu.
(B.3). SCAN Scheduling
Algoritma ini menitik beratkan pada pergerakan disk yang dimulai dari salah
satu ujung disk, kemudian bergerak menuju ujung yng lain sambil melayani permitaan
setiap kali mengunjungi masing-masing silinder. Jika telah sampai di ujung disk, maka
disk akan bergerak berlawanan arah, Jika telah mulai lagi melayani permintaan-
permintaan yang muncul, maka pergerakan disk adalah bolak-balik.
(B.4). C-SCAN Scehduling
Algoritma C-Scan ini akan menyediakan waktu tunggu yang sama. Prinsip
kerjanya hampir sama dengan algoritma scan yaitu akan menggerakan head dari satu
ujung disk ke ujung disk yang lainnya sambil pelayani permintaan yang terdapat selama
pergerakan tersebut. Tetapi , saat head telah tiba di salah satu ujung, maka head tidak
balik arah melayani permintaan-permintaan berikutnya melainkan akan kembali ke
ujung disk asal pergerakanya.
155